Divis Laboratories: Analytical Perspective Shifts Amid Mixed Financial and Technical Signals

Divis Laboratories, a prominent player in the Pharmaceuticals & Biotechnology sector, has experienced a revision in its market assessment following a detailed review of its quality, valuation, financial trends, and technical indicators. This article explores the factors influencing the recent changes in the company’s evaluation metrics, providing investors with a comprehensive understanding of its current standing.



Quality Assessment Reflects Strong Operational Efficiency


Divis Laboratories continues to demonstrate robust operational metrics, underscored by a return on equity (ROE) of 17.24%, signalling effective management utilisation of shareholder funds. The company’s return on capital employed (ROCE) for the half-year period stands at 20.94%, indicating efficient capital deployment relative to earnings generation. Additionally, the firm has maintained positive quarterly results for five consecutive periods, reinforcing its operational consistency.


Financial prudence is evident in Divis Laboratories’ capital structure, with an average debt-to-equity ratio of zero, highlighting a conservative approach to leverage. This low indebtedness reduces financial risk and provides flexibility for future investments or expansions. Institutional investors hold a significant 39.16% stake in the company, reflecting confidence from entities with extensive analytical resources and a long-term investment horizon.


Despite these strengths, the company’s long-term sales growth rate of 9.86% annually and operating profit growth of 5.38% over the past five years suggest moderate expansion relative to sector peers. While the firm’s market capitalisation of ₹1,70,829 crores places it as the second largest in its sector, its annual sales of ₹10,029 crores represent just 2.20% of the industry total, indicating room for scaling operations further.

Valuation Signals Suggest Premium Pricing Relative to Peers


Divis Laboratories is currently trading at a price-to-book value of 11.1, which is considered high compared to historical averages within the Pharmaceuticals & Biotechnology sector. This elevated valuation reflects market expectations of sustained earnings growth and operational excellence but also implies limited margin for valuation expansion.


The company’s price-to-earnings growth (PEG) ratio stands at 1.9, indicating that the stock price incorporates a premium relative to its earnings growth rate. Over the past year, the stock has generated a return of 4.14%, while profits have increased by 35.4%, suggesting that market pricing may already factor in much of the recent earnings momentum.


Such valuation levels warrant cautious consideration, especially given the company’s moderate long-term sales and profit growth rates. Investors may weigh the premium against the firm’s quality metrics and sector positioning before making allocation decisions.



Financial Trend Analysis Highlights Consistent Profitability Amid Moderate Growth


Divis Laboratories’ quarterly net sales reached ₹2,715 crores, marking the highest level recorded in recent periods. The company’s dividend per share (DPS) for the year is ₹30.00, reflecting a shareholder-friendly approach and steady cash flow generation.


While the firm’s financial performance in the second quarter of fiscal year 2025-26 shows positive trends, the annualised growth rates over five years for net sales and operating profit remain modest at 9.86% and 5.38%, respectively. This suggests that while the company maintains profitability and operational efficiency, its expansion pace is relatively measured within the competitive pharmaceutical landscape.


Comparatively, the Sensex has delivered a year-to-date return of 9.60%, outpacing Divis Laboratories’ 5.50% return over the same period. Over a 10-year horizon, however, Divis Laboratories has outperformed the Sensex with a cumulative return of 466.14% against 227.26%, underscoring its long-term value creation capabilities.



Technical Indicators Reflect a Shift to Mildly Bullish Momentum


Recent assessment changes in Divis Laboratories’ technical outlook reveal a transition from a strongly bullish trend to a mildly bullish stance. Weekly technical indicators such as the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) and the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ator maintain bullish signals, while monthly indicators present a more cautious picture with mildly bearish tendencies.


The Relative Strength Index (RSI) on both weekly and monthly charts currently shows no definitive signal, suggesting a neutral momentum phase. Bollinger Bands indicate mild bullishness across weekly and monthly timeframes, while daily moving averages continue to support a positive trend.


Other technical measures, including Dow Theory and On-Balance Volume (OBV), do not indicate a clear trend on weekly or monthly scales, reflecting a period of consolidation or indecision among market participants. The stock’s price movement today ranged between ₹6,403 and ₹6,517.95, closing slightly lower at ₹6,435 compared to the previous close of ₹6,478.95.

Sector Positioning and Market Capitalisation


With a market capitalisation of ₹1,70,829 crores, Divis Laboratories ranks as the second largest company within the Pharmaceuticals & Biotechnology sector, trailing only Sun Pharmaceutical Industries. The company accounts for 7.19% of the sector’s total market value, underscoring its significant presence.


Despite its sizeable market cap, Divis Laboratories’ annual sales represent a modest 2.20% share of the industry’s total revenue, highlighting potential for growth in market penetration or product diversification. The stock’s 52-week price range spans from ₹4,941.70 to ₹7,077.70, reflecting volatility and investor sentiment fluctuations over the past year.



Conclusion: Balanced Viewpoint Amid Mixed Signals


The recent revision in Divis Laboratories’ evaluation metrics reflects a nuanced view of its current market position. The company’s strong operational efficiency, conservative capital structure, and consistent profitability provide a solid foundation. However, premium valuation levels and moderate long-term growth rates introduce caution for investors seeking aggressive expansion plays.


Technical indicators suggest a tempered bullish momentum, indicating that while the stock retains positive undercurrents, it may be entering a phase of consolidation. Investors should consider these factors in conjunction with sector dynamics and broader market trends when assessing Divis Laboratories’ potential role within their portfolios.


Overall, the shift in market assessment underscores the importance of a multi-dimensional analysis encompassing quality, valuation, financial trends, and technical signals to form a comprehensive investment perspective.
